Method 1: Contact Your Local DMV (Free)

Check with your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) to look up a license plate and find its owner. The DMV keeps a record of every vehicle in the state. The next step is to find a DMV in your local area and submit your request online, by mail, or in person.

Note that the DMV has rigid rules on license plate lookups. They may even require a totally separate process for that, which would ask you for documentation indicating what the information will be used for. Also, searching for the owner of a license plate at the DMV office is free in most states; however, printed copies of the documents may require a small fee.

Method 2: Manually Search It on Internet/Social Media Platforms (Free)

Another way to find the owner of a license plate is to take a shot at internet search engines (Google, Bing, Yahoo…) or social media platforms (Instagram, Facebook, YouTube…). It usually works when this license plate has been transferred online, in a major accident, or belongs to a famous person.

However, it’s essential to note that using this method might not always yield accurate or updated information. Privacy concerns and legal limitations also dictate the availability and accuracy of license plate owner information online. Moreover, relying on unverified information found through internet searches should be done cautiously and ethically, respecting the privacy of others.

Fun facts about license plates:

  • Oldest Plate: The first-ever license plate in the U.S. was issued in 1903 by the state of New York. It was made of iron and measured 3 inches by 6 inches.
  • Different Designs: Each state in the U.S. has its own unique license plate design. These designs often reflect the state’s culture, history, or natural features. Some states even offer specialized plates for various causes or organizations.
  • Variety of Materials: License plates have been made from various materials over time, including porcelain, steel, aluminum, and plastic. This shift in materials was partly due to durability and cost considerations.
  • Specialty Plates: Many states offer specialty or vanity plates that allow drivers to customize their plates with personalized messages or symbols, contributing to revenue for specific causes or organizations.
  • Digital License Plates: Some states in the U.S. have begun experimenting with digital license plates that can display messages, track vehicles, or change registration details electronically.
  • Most Stolen Plate: Colorado, District of Columbia, and Washington had the highest rates of stolen license plates in the U.S.
  • Collectors’ Items: Old or rare license plates have become collectors’ items, and there is a vibrant market for vintage or specialty plates among enthusiasts.

exclamation-blueThere’s no guarantee you’ll find the information you’re looking for with the tools discussed in this article. They all source their information from publicly available data sources, such as county, state and federal courts, government departments, and police records, and those sources may contain incorrect or incomplete data. It’s illegal to use these tools to make decisions about employment, admission, consumer credit, insurance, tenant screening, or any other purpose that would require FCRA compliance.
